my Top 10 Sports achievements of the Decade

1) The Boston Red Sox win the ALCS after being down 0-3 to their arch-rivals the New York Yankees, go on to win their first World Series in 86 years
2) Lance Armstrong wins the Tour de France 7 straight times
3) Michael Phelps wins 8 gold medals at the 2008 Olympics
4) The New York Giants stop the New Englands Patriots' perfect season in Super Bowl XLII
5) The Texas Longhorns led by Vince Young beat behemoth USC in the 2006 Rose Bowl, the greatest college bowl game ever played.
6) Kobe Bryant and Shaquille O' Neal lead the L.A. Lakers to 3 straight NBA titles (one of which stolen from the Sacramento Kings by shady refs but whatevs)
7) S.F. Giants star Barry Bonds passes Hank Aaron's all-time Home Run record (also shady but hey I witnessed plenty of those dingers!)
8) Tennis stars Venus and Serena Williams dominate the decade in Grand Slam singles and doubles wins
9) George Mason University makes the 2006 NCAA Men's Basketball Final Four as a #11 seed
10) The Fresno State Bulldogs Baseball team wins the 2008 College World Series in a historic underdog victory (the photo below is mine from the victory rally)
